Cabinet and Commercial Millwork Installer
1 day ago
Are you handy? Are you interested in working with tools on a variety of projects?
We are a leading architectural millwork company located in Waterloo, Ontario and we are currently looking for an enthusiastic, motivated, and dedicated employee to become a Cabinet and Commercial Millwork Installer for our Client Care team.
We are committed to the successful installation and deficiency clean-up with our millwork on a project site and, as such, we are looking for a dynamic individual who is willing to support our custom cabinetry installation and rectify on-site deficiencies.
**Duties and Responsibilities**:
This position reports to the Field Operations Manager and works closely with our Project Management team. This position is part of our Client Care division and works both inside and outside the CCW shop; it is expected that this employee presents themselves in a professional manner when interacting with clients and/or contractors at project sites.
Duties will include, but will not be limited to, commercial and residential millwork installation as required.
- Install a variety of custom millwork and interior fabrication pieces across a diverse range of job sites, including restaurant, hotel, condominium, office, retail, institutional and residential spaces
- Provide after-project care, including the completion of millwork deficiencies
- Provide assistance on the shop floor using cabinet making skills when service work is limited
- Take or confirm site dimensions/templates for fabrication purposes
- Assess and detail additional items that may be requested by the client or end user, to be used for estimating and manufacturing purposes
- Unload and inspect product delivered to site
- Submit a daily report, complete with photographs of work progress and/or issues, to the Field Operations Manager and/or Project Manager
- Regular travel to project sites across Ontario
Skills Required:
- Solid understanding of carpentry and custom millwork
- Advanced understanding of woodworking and installation techniques an asset
- Solid understanding of woodworking machinery i.e. table saw, planer, jointer, mitre saws, and routers
- Ability to read and understand blueprints/shop drawings an asset
- Good knowledge of various woodworking and construction materials
- Punctual, courteous and presentable
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Ability to lift 50-75lbs
- Must be able to work as an individual and as a team member
- Follow all proper maintenance, sanitation and health and safety protocols
- Perform duties in an organized and productive manner in a fast-paced environment
- Valid Driver’s License and clean driving record
